The Peninsular & Oriental Steam Navigation Company cruise ship Viceroy of India (1929) at anchor off the coast at Spitsbergen, Norway.
A distant port side view, taken from well abaft the beam, of the Peninsular & Oriental Steam Navigation Company cruise ship Viceroy of India (1929) at anchor off the coast at Spitsbergen, Norway. The photographer is on a shore excursion from the ship and a single masted wooden ship is drawn up on shore, possibly hulked, to the left of centre of the picture. A landing stage is on the right and three of the ship's boats are shuttling between the ship and the shore. Snow covered mountains and two glaciers are in the background on the far side of a sea inlet.
